
Here we will show you step-by-step how to simplify the cube root of 3512. Before we continue, note that the cube root of 3512 can be written as follows:
∛3512
The ∛ symbol is called the radical sign. To simplify the cube root of 3512 means to get the simplest radical form of ∛3512.
Step 1: List Factors
We start by listing the factors of 3512 like so:
1, 2, 4, 8, 439, 878, 1756, and 3512
Step 2: Find Perfect Cubes
Next, we identify the perfect cubes* from the list of factors above:
1 and 8
Step 3: Find the number to go inside the radical
From the list of perfect cubes, you see that 8 is the largest perfect cube. Now, divide 3512 by the largest perfect cube to find the number that will go inside the radical.
3512 / 8 = 439
Step 4: Find the number to go outside the radical
To find the number that will go outside the radical, we simply calculate the cube root of the largest perfect cube:
∛8 = 2
Step 5: Get the answer
Put Steps 3 and 4 together to get the cube root of 3512 in its simplest radical form. You put the result from Step 3 inside the radical and the result from Step 4 outside the radical:
2∛439
There you have it folks! Now you know how to simplify the cube root of 3512. The answer to the cube root of 3512 in its simplest radical form is displayed below:
∛3512 = 2∛439
